Grants paid by Alpine Education Services

EIN 47-3863601 · Houston, TX ·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E B11

Alpine Education Services of Houston, TX (EIN 47-3863601) reported 7 grants paid totaling $4,556,684 to 2 recipients in tax years 2018–2025, on Form 990, Schedule I.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
